AutoTFL
A working R environment for repeatable clinical analysis and TFL production.
A production R Shiny application for clinical data analysis and reproducible table, figure, and listing workflows.
Product Owner · Statistician · Statistical Programmer · Primary Builder
01 / Workflow change
One modular workflow covers data preparation, statistical methods, medical graphics, reusable output templates, task state, and multi-format export.

Current data workflows cover single and batch intake, filtering, column mapping, and variable-information preparation.

Current statistical methods cover descriptive analysis, Cox, logistic and linear regression, ANOVA, chi-square, and CMH.

Medical graphics include survival, forest, swimmer, waterfall, spider, combination, box, heatmap, and correlation views with shared display and export sizing rules.

Preset outputs and Word, PDF, and HTML export support reusable table, figure, and listing delivery.
